Let Go of Clutter: A Guide to Decluttering
Are you feeling buried by the amount of stuff in your life? It's easy to let things accumulate, but a cluttered home can lead to a cluttered mind. Decluttering is about more than just getting rid of unwanted items; it's about creating space for what truly matters. A clear and organized environment can help reduce stress, improve focus, and boost your overall well-being.
- Start by identifying the areas in your home that are most chaotic.
- Set aside dedicated time for decluttering, even if it's just an hour at a time.
- Group your belongings into three piles: keep, donate, and discard.
- Resist be afraid to let go of items that you no longer use or need.
- When you've decluttered a space, take time to organize the remaining items in a efficient way.
Remember, decluttering is a habit. Be patient with yourself and celebrate your successes along the way. With each step you take, you'll be clearing your mind and creating a more peaceful and fulfilling life.
